Scientific Data Images for RanGAP1 Antibody - BSA Free
Western Blot: RanGAP1 Antibody [NBP1-18915]
Western Blot: RanGAP1 Antibody [NBP1-18915] - Detection of human and mouse RanGAP1 by western blot. Samples: Whole cell lysate (50 ug) from HeLa, HEK293T, Jurkat, mouse TCMK-1, and mouse NIH 3T3 cells prepared using NETN lysis buffer. Antibodies: Affinity purified rabbit anti-RanGAP1 antibody NBP1-18915 used for WB at 0.1 ug/ml. Detection: Chemiluminescence with an exposure time of 30 seconds.Immunohistochemistry: RanGAP1 Antibody [NBP1-18915]
Immunohistochemistry: RanGAP1 Antibody [NBP1-18915] - Detection of human RanGAP1 by immunohistochemistry. Samples: FFPE sections of human prostate carcinoma. Antibody: Affinity purified rabbit anti-RanGAP1 Cat. No. NBP1-18915 (left) and another rabbit anti-RanGAP1 antibody (right) used at a dilution 1ug/ml. Detection: DABImmunoprecipitation: RanGAP1 Antibody [NBP1-18915]
Immunoprecipitation: RanGAP1 Antibody [NBP1-18915] - Detection of human RanGAP1 by western blot of immunoprecipitates. Samples: Whole cell lysate (0.5 or 1.0 mg per IP reaction; 20% of IP loaded) from HeLa cells prepared using NETN lysis buffer. Antibodies: Affinity purified rabbit anti-RanGAP1 antibody NBP1-18915 used for IP at 6 ug per reaction. RanGAP1 was also immunoprecipitated by another rabbit anti-RanGAP1 antibody. For blotting immunoprecipitated RanGAP1, NBP1-18915 was used at 0.4 ug/ml. Detection: Chemiluminescence with an exposure time of 30 seconds.Applications for RanGAP1 Antibody - BSA Free
